Pagewood's Pipes: The Local Story
Private developers laid this suburb out in 1919 under the Monash Gardens name. The double-brick houses that filled in afterward are why streets such as Banks Avenue and Wentworth Avenue still carry that post-war look.
A newer chapter has since arrived where the GM Holden factory used to stand, now home to Meriton's apartment precinct and a run of fresh townhouses.
That precinct changes the shape of a plumbing emergency. A single detached house losing hot water is one household's problem.
A shared plant serving a block that size failing outright affects every resident on the system at once, a different kind of urgent call to manage.
Underneath all of it sits the Botany Sands Aquifer, and the water table here runs shallow. Trenching for a repair or a new connection can hit groundwater within a few metres of the surface, which changes how a below-ground job gets done.
That same flat, sandy ground struggles to absorb a heavy downpour. The Springvale and Floodvale Drain catchment covers this pocket, and its system backs up fast once rain lands hard on already-saturated streets, worse still when a high tide in Botany Bay is pushing back the other way.
We treat that surcharge risk as a blocked drains job first, checking the connection before anything else, because a slow drain in this pocket is often a sign the whole line is under pressure.

The Problems We See Around Pagewood
Three other faults turn up often enough that we plan for them.
Flexi-hose failures in newer kitchens. Renovated houses and the townhouses going up across the suburb rely on braided flexi hoses under sinks, and when one gives way the kitchen is standing in water before anyone's noticed.
Hot water units past their prime. Original systems in the older post-war brick houses are commonly still in service well beyond a sensible age, usually giving out without any notice, often on the coldest morning of the month.
Sewer connections that surcharge, not just slow down. Combine ageing drainage with that shallow water table and a heavy rain event, and the line backs up rather than merely running sluggish.

Winter puts extra strain on ageing hot water units right when nobody wants a cold shower. That's often when a tired unit finally quits for good.
A few situations are worth ringing about the moment they happen.
- Water pooling on a floor faster than towels can keep up.
- The whole house without a trace of hot water.
- A toilet backing up rather than draining, and no second bathroom in the house.
- A fitting or joint that's clearly given way, not just seeping.
- If you smell gas, leave the property and call from outside. Do not flick switches or light flames.
Otherwise, the water meter is your fastest way to cut the flow. We answer any hour, real humans, not an answering machine.
